Is hot sauce still good when it turns brown?
The presence of discolored hot sauce is typically not a cause for concern. Due to oxidation, many hot sauces will eventually turn from their original colors of red, green, or orange to brown. This is a natural process that occurs when your spicy sauce comes into touch with the air, causing it to break down its chemical structure and become more flavorful.
How can you tell if hot sauce has gone bad?
How do you tell if a hot sauce bottle has been opened and is rotten or spoiled? Smelling and inspecting the hot sauce is the most effective method: if the hot sauce acquires an off-odor, flavor, and appearance, or if mold emerges, it should be thrown as soon as possible.

How long does hot sauce burn last?
That sensation of having your lips on fire only lasts for a short period of time. It will gradually fade away since the sense of heat and discomfort is caused by a chemical process and will disappear after the capsaicin molecules have neutralized and have stopped connecting to the receptors. Currie estimates that this process takes roughly 20 minutes on average.

Should hot sauce be refrigerated after opening?
Once you open the bottle of spicy sauce, it turns out that you don’t have to put it back in the refrigerator. Yes, you are correct. It is possible to store spicy sauce in your cupboard or cabinet at room temperature for literally years without risk of spoilage. For example, some spicy sauces, such as Tabasco, can change color over time if they are not kept chilled.

Does Tabasco sauce expire?
The shelf life of Tabasco varies depending on the kind you purchase. It takes five years to use up the original Tabasco sauce; the Tabasco Garlic Pepper and Habanero sauces last two years; and the Green Jalapeno Pepper and Chipotle Pepper sauces are only good for 18 months.

Is my fermented hot sauce Safe?
Hot sauces containing vinegar, fermented peppers, and capsaicin are less prone to spoil than other types of hot sauce. They work together to lower the pH level, effectively eliminating any bacterial activity. For the sake of safety, I recommend that you keep your fermented hot sauce refrigerated if the recipe calls for fruits, vegetables, or eggs.

Do you need to refrigerate fermented hot sauce?
A fermented spicy sauce must be kept refrigerated, or it must be boiled with vinegar or citric acid to make it shelf stable, in order to be used. This completely eliminates all bacterial activity, allowing the sauces to be shelf-stable while also no longer being probiotic in nature.
